What affects the price

When planning a hardscape project, several factors influence your final investment. The total square footage is the primary driver, but the complexity of the design—such as curves, patterns, or multi-level tiers—adds to labor time. Site accessibility matters too; if crews need specialized equipment to move materials into a tight backyard, that affects the bottom line. Material choice, from standard concrete blocks to premium natural stone, significantly shifts the budget. Additionally, your current ground condition determines how much excavation and base preparation is required for long-term stability.

What are system pavers in San Angelo?

System pavers in San Angelo often refer to interlocking paver systems designed for specific applications, like drainage or permeable surfaces. These pavers allow water to pass through them, which can be beneficial for managing rainwater. They are a good choice for patios and walkways where water runoff is a concern. Their design also contributes to a stable and durable surface.

What are the considerations for a concrete patio in San Angelo?

When considering a concrete patio in San Angelo, think about its durability and permanence. Concrete is a strong material, but it can crack over time due to temperature changes. It also offers fewer design options compared to pavers. While often initially cheaper, repairs can be more complex. Proper sealing is important to protect it from the elements in San Angelo.
